I'm thinking of a parallel way of the music streamer: You have pictures in a directory on your server and the pictures are 'transcoded' (resized) into a viewable format (~100kb jpg's). You need to be able to convert big jpg's as well as all the RAW formats. For Linux the tool Ufraw could be linked to this feature.
